Words of the week

-

BRITAIN will succeed whatever happens. – Transport Secretary Chris Grayling on Brexit.

THE disruption for Britain could be, you know, quite serious. – Hillary Clinton on the prospect of a no-deal Brexit.

THIS is the politics of Al Capone. This is

extortion. – Tory peer and former Cabinet Minister Lord Forsyth on the “divorce bill” demands by the EU. WE live in a world riven by conflict, spurred on by ego and neo-imperial ambition. – Jeremy Corbyn.

I DON’T miss the nastiness of social

media. – Former Labour MP Dame Anne Begg’s response when asked what she missed about Parliament.

READERS and writers, it’s all

downhill from now. – Author George Saunders after winning the Booker Prize with his debut novel Lincoln in the Bardo. YES, I’m flawed, but my intentions are good, and I will never be perfect, but I will continue to evolve toward that. – Jane Fonda.

IT’S the most fun you could have with your

clothes on! – Amateur rider David Maxwell, 39, after winning Wetherby’s Bobby Renton Chase on his own horse Ballotin. ONE of the greatest causes of stress in the world was the invention of the shower. – Tory MP Tim Loughton who begins each day with an hour-long session in the bath.

YOU should come into space with

me. – Actor Brian Blessed, who hopes to blast into space next year, issues an invitation to the Duchess of Cornwall. I AM ashamed to say that I go to the theatre maybe once every 10 years. I know that makes me a disgrace as an actor and that I should go and should love it, but I can’t bear it. – Hugh Grant.

I’M being very, very nice, but at some point I fight back and it won’t be pretty. – President Donald Trump’s warning to Republican Senator John McCain, who questioned “half-baked, spurious nationalis­m” in US foreign policy. THERE is a man in the White House who lies consistent­ly and pathologic­ally and is an open and avowed racist, and misogynist, and sexual predator. – Actor Jason Isaacs attacks President Trump.
